Recognizing the Fundamentals: Realtors vs. Real Estate Professionals



When you're diving right into the globe of realty, it's critical to comprehend the distinction between Realtors and realty agents. While both professionals help you get or sell buildings, not all agents are Realtors. Real estate professionals are licensed representatives that are participants of the National Association of Realtors (NAR) This subscription symbolizes a commitment to a stringent code of ethics, ensuring a higher requirement of solution.

Commission Frameworks: Exactly How Payment Functions



When you're getting a home, comprehending commission structures is necessary. You'll need to know exactly how commission rates work, that is accountable for repayment, and whether you can work out those charges. This understanding can conserve you cash and aid you make educated decisions.


Compensation Rates Explained



Comprehending compensation rates is vital for homebuyers steering the real estate market. Typically, genuine estate commissions vary from 5% to 6% of the home's sale cost, split between the purchaser's and seller's agents. While steering the genuine estate landscape, it's essential to understand exactly how settlement duties function, specifically relating to commission frameworks. Normally, when you buy a home, the seller pays the compensation for both the listing representative and the buyer's representative. This suggests you typically don't need to pay your representative straight; their costs come from the sale price. Payment rates can differ, yet they generally vary from 5% to 6% of the home's price, split between the agents included. What Is the Ordinary Commission Rate for Realtors?



The average commission price for real estate agents normally ranges from 5% to 6% of the home's list price. This fee's typically divided in between the customer's and seller's representatives, though it can vary based on area and contract.


Are There Any Additional Costs When Working With a Realtor?



Yes, there can be added costs when hiring a real estate agent. These may consist of administrative fees, marketing costs, or deal charges. It's vital to go over all prospective expenses upfront to avoid shocks later.
